What are basic crochet stitches?

The foundation chain (or base chain) Almost all crochet starts with a foundation (or base) chain. This is the equivalent of ‘casting on’ in knitting. The base chain is a series of chain stitches, which normally begin with a loop secured by a slipknot.

What are the different crochet patterns?

There are many different types of crochet stitches. A few stitches are chain, single, half double, double, treble, puff, cluster, popcorn, and many others. Stitches can be worked by themselves are in combinations to make various patterns. Crochet can be worked in straight lines or in the round.

What is a basic crochet stitch?

crochet stitch – any one of a number of stitches made by pulling a loop of yarn through another loop with a crochet needle. chain stitch – the most basic of all crochet stitches made by pulling a loop of yarn through another loop. double crochet, double stitch – a kind of crochet stitch.
